Some of you will already know of this one but for those who don't, Russ Hore, one of the MRMap developer team and writer of the ini file editing application to be found elsewhere in this site, has now begun the testing phase of a method of locating the mobile phone of a casualty, misper or informant etc without there being any need to place any apps or code of any kind onto the mobile phone itself apart from the built in Java scripting that actually does all the work after which it sends your location to the server for display to the team.
The results of testing the system can be seen at http://www.russ-hore.co.uk/locate_them.php
The system uses a variety of methods to locate the phone after it has been sent a SMS text message containing a web address. The wording of this SMS would be such that if the phone's user doesn't want to be found then they delete the message but by clicking on the web address contained in the message, the user gives his or her agreement that the system will be brought into play and the location of the phone calculated.
As I understand it, the system can use the GPS built into the phone but can also work even if there isn't a GPS receiver in the phone. Obviously position accuracy isn't then quite as good but it's still reasonable from the stand point of a rescue team. The phone does need to be web enabled however and you do need to have Java Scripting enabled which isn't the default condition on some phones
The proposed use for this is not as a tracking device but to enable a rescue team to pin-point the location of the phone they are talking to. It's immediate value would be in the location of all those lost and lonely walkers who continue to be surprised that it gets dark at night. These are time consuming jobs where there is no injury and if they can be made easier for the teams then it's worth Russ' efforts just for that! This is a one-shot system if all goes to plan. Once the location has been determined then it's no longer needed and the team can set off in reasonable confidence that they are heading in the right direction. In my own experience, this is often not the case if all you do is to ask the informant where they are. If you're searching for them because they're lost then it logically follows that they don't know where they are and any location information they give you is unreliable. Russ' system should help in these cases.
Yes, mobile phone coverage is far from perfect. Yes, 3G coverage is even worse but there are places where it works and where I believe this system would be a significant help to search teams. Basically anything that is potentially of benefit to the casualty deserves a try out.
To date Russ has achieved position accuracies of down to a few tens of metres which is within earshot of someone blowing a whistle etc.
I have to emphasise a number of things.
The work is at testing stage but isn't yet finished. Many thanks to all those team members who came forward and offered to test for us!
Russ' system doesn't require any software to be present on the phone itself apart from Java scripting which is already on most phones.
The data received by the system is currently displayed on a web site that would be visible to the rescue team. However the data is such that it can easily be pushed onto the MRMap server and so your casualty location would appear on MRMap.
It provides what is really a one off location rather than a continuous tracking function you are all already familiar with.
